Description
We developed spatiotemporal landslide hazard maps (LHMs) using soil, hydrologic, and geomorphic parameters from the subaerial infinite slope factor of safety (FS) equation under unsaturated conditions. Soil properties were extracted from the NRCS WSS, while geomorphic variables were derived from a 1.5 m LiDAR-based DEM and ArcGIS Online. Soil moisture from Hydrus-1D, driven by precipitation and evapotranspiration (ET) data from Irrigation Manager, introduced temporal variability. Validation against known landslide sites showed spatial and temporal FS accuracy despite some false positives. We also developed a landslide susceptibility maps (LSM) after comparing three machine learning algorithms, with bagged trees achieving the highest ROC AUC. This framework demonstrates the feasibility of producing near real-time predictive maps using publicly available data.

Related Content
O'Leary, Nathaniel, "VISUALIZING AND AUTOMATING PAST, REAL-TIME, AND FORECAST DYNAMIC HAZARD MAPS FOR SHALLOW COLLUVIAL LANDSLIDES IN EASTERN KENTUCKY" (2024). Theses and Dissertations--Earth and Environmental Sciences. 110. https://doi.org/10.13023/etd.2024.430
Landslide data pertaining to the location and reported date of the landslide - Kentucky Geological Survey (KGS) Landslide Inventory: https://kgs.uky.edu/kgsmap/helpfiles/landslide_help.shtm
Geomorphic and topological data were derived from the 1.5 m LiDAR digital elevation model (DEM) - Kentucky Elevation Data and Aerial Photography Program: https://kyfromabove.ky.gov
Land cover data - 2016 National Land Cover Database (NLCD) product suite: https://www.mrlc.gov/
Soil property data -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S) Web Soil Survey (WSS): https://websoilsurvey.sc.egov.usda.gov/App/HomePage.htm
Evapotranspiration and precipitation data - Irrigation Manager, Ag Weather Center, Department of Biosystems & Agricultural Engineering, University of Kentucky. http://weather.uky.edu/php/cal_et.php
